5.5.1.6 Canser GPS
For the Canser GPS, there are only two blinking codes which indicate an external error.
No GPS-mouse connected; contact to mouse lost
CAN-transfer disturbed:
CAN-Bus not connected or no further participants on bus
No GPS-data since CAN-transmission was disturbed
5.5.1.7 µ-CANSAS and µ-CANSAS-HUB4
imc µ-CANSAS-HUB4:
There are two status-LEDs for the imc µ-CANSAS-HUB4, a green one to the right of CAN OUT and a red
one next to CAN IN.
It is possible to set which of the two LEDs indicates normal operation, and by which flashing pattern.
When the module is started, the red LED flashes briefly. Next it darkens again, or flashes according to the
specified pattern in case the red LED was set to indicate normal operation mode.
The imc µ-CANSAS-HUB4’s four inputs (IN1...IN4) each have their own status-LED. If no module is
connected at the input, the corresponding LED remains off. If a module was detected at the input and if
that module was last configured at the same input, then its associated LED shines solid green. If a module
was detected at the input whose configuration does not match that of the module most recently
configured at the same input, then its associated LED shines solid red. If a module was unplugged from
the input, the associated LED goes dark.
Additionally, the note pertaining to 4-channel imc µ-CANSAS modules also applies here.
1-channel imc µ-CANSAS module at the imc µ-CANSAS-HUB4 or in synchronized operation:
The red LED shines until synchronization with the imc µ-CANSAS-HUB4 or another CAN1 Master module
is complete and the module begins transmitting measured values. The green LED behaves according to
the configuration given to it by the user both during and after the synchronization phase.
4-channel imc µ-CANSAS module:
For each input (IN1...IN4) and for the overall module there is one 2-color LED. After startup, the module
LED (LED next to CAN IN) briefly flashes red. The inputs’ LEDs behave like the LEDs description in
Synchronization for as Slave working modules.
A 4-channel imc µ-CANSAS module responds like four 1-channel imc µ-CANSAS modules all
connected to one HUB4. For each channel, a page for the LED is displayed. This must also be set if
you wish to see that the channel has been recorded and balanced in synchronicity.
